Shah Rukh emotionally touched

By Staff

Tuesday, May 08, 2007
Shah Rukh Khan who is in Doha, emotionally choked a little when a local journalist thanked him for praying for speedy recovery of his daughter several years ago. Reminiscing that he had lost both his parents at an early age, King Khan said the prayer was one that his father always recited to him when he was a little boy.

SRK, who was in Doha to mark the opening of ICICI Bank's branch at the Qatar Financial Centre (QFC), swept the audience off their feet on Friday with his disarming smile, ready wit and down-to-earth demeanor.

The two-hour interactive session was peppered with songs, dance and give-away gifts, SRK interacted with the audience and invited fans to join him on stage. It was during one such interaction the journalist disarmed him by voicing gratitude.

Khan who lost his parents before he made it big in Bollywood reminisces about them often. In Doha too he reflected back to the bond he shared with his deceased parents.

He was quick to not linger on the rare exposure to his sensitive side, though. Like a true actor, the Khan switched emotions, challenging everyone in the audience to bank a million dollars each with ICICI if they wanted him back in Doha for a repeat performance.
